How much do you really know about Saudi Arabia's complex relationship with the United States? Do you fully understand why Russia invaded Ukraine?
Right from the Start is a collection of essays that will help you get to the bottom of these and many other complex issues in international politics today. This book will help organize your thoughts and help formulate your own conclusions. Right from the Start is written by David H. Rundell and Michael Gfoeller, two distinguished former diplomats with over fifty years of political analysis experience in Washington, the Middle East, and the former Soviet Union. Rooted in realism, it challenges conventional narratives and calls for a foreign policy prioritizing American interests in our world today. The authors point out that a small nation like Ukraine is unlikely to defeat a large nation like Russia without foreign intervention on a scale that risks provoking a major war. They discuss the dramatic social and economic changes taking place in Saudi Arabia and explain why the Kingdom's stability remains important to the United States. Turning to domestic issues, they provide insightful commentary on State Department reform, school shootings, nationwide court injunctions, and a host of other topics.
